Add doc/ dependencies on emacsver.texi.
authorGlenn Morris <rgm@gnu.org>
Sat, 9 Oct 2010 02:09:46 +0000 (19:09 -0700)
committerGlenn Morris <rgm@gnu.org>
Sat, 9 Oct 2010 02:09:46 +0000 (19:09 -0700)
* doc/misc/Makefile.in ($(infodir)/efaq): Depend on emacsver.texi.

* doc/lispref/Makefile.in (srcs): Add emacsver.texi.

* doc/emacs/Makefile.in (EMACSSOURCES): Add emacsver.texi.

doc/emacs/ChangeLog
doc/emacs/Makefile.in
doc/lispref/ChangeLog
doc/lispref/Makefile.in
doc/misc/ChangeLog
doc/misc/Makefile.in

index 773799d..9eecf44 100644 (file)
@@ -4,6 +4,7 @@
        * emacs.texi: Set EMACSVER by including emacsver.texi.
        * Makefile.in (distclean): Delete emacsver.texi.
        (dist): Copy emacsver.texi.
+       (EMACSSOURCES): Add emacsver.texi.
 
        * ack.texi (Acknowledgments): No more b2m.c.
 
index 02fdbd4..d877a92 100644 (file)
@@ -70,6 +70,7 @@ EMACS_XTRA= \
        $(srcdir)/msdog-xtra.texi
 
 EMACSSOURCES= \
+       ${srcdir}/emacsver.texi \
        ${srcdir}/emacs.texi \
        ${srcdir}/doclicense.texi \
        ${srcdir}/gpl.texi \
index c3ed7e6..8a3242a 100644 (file)
@@ -3,6 +3,8 @@
        * Makefile.in (emacsdir): New variable.
        (MAKEINFO): Add -I $emacsdir.
        (dist): Copy emacsver.texi.
+       (srcs): Add emacsver.texi.
+
        * book-spine.texinfo, elisp.texi, vol2.texi, vol1.texi:
        Set EMACSVER by including emacsver.texi.
 
index 9cca29e..4336a25 100644 (file)
@@ -42,6 +42,7 @@ TEXI2PDF = texi2pdf
 # List of all the texinfo files in the manual:
 
 srcs = \
+  $(emacsdir)/emacsver.texi \
   $(srcdir)/abbrevs.texi \
   $(srcdir)/advice.texi \
   $(srcdir)/anti.texi \
index 4a98d54..3d83437 100644 (file)
@@ -4,6 +4,8 @@
 
        * Makefile.in (emacsdir): New variable.
        ($(infodir)/efaq): Pass -I $(emacsdir) to makeinfo.
+       Depend on emacsver.texi.
+
        * faq.texi (VER): Replace with EMACSVER from emacsver.texi.
 
        * Makefile.in (.PHONY): Declare info, dvi, pdf and the clean rules.
index 8b4b2c5..153aaa4 100644 (file)
@@ -364,7 +364,7 @@ eudc.pdf: eudc.texi
        $(ENVADD) $(TEXI2PDF) ${srcdir}/eudc.texi
 
 efaq : $(infodir)/efaq
-$(infodir)/efaq: faq.texi $(infodir)
+$(infodir)/efaq: faq.texi $(emacsdir)/emacsver.texi $(infodir)
        cd $(srcdir); $(MAKEINFO) -I $(emacsdir) faq.texi
 faq.dvi: faq.texi
        $(ENVADD) $(TEXI2DVI) ${srcdir}/faq.texi